ADGP Jammu Reviews Crime, law & Order in Samba District

Emphasizes on Case Disposal and Preventive Measures

Additional Director General of Police (ADGP) for Jammu Zone, Anand Jain today conducted a comprehensive crime review meeting at the Conference Hall of the District Police Office (DPO) Samba. The meeting, attended by a host of law enforcement officials including Additional SP Samba, ASP SDPO Mukand Tibrewal, Supervisory Officers, Station House Officers (SHOs), and Incharge Police Posts, aimed at assessing the prevailing crime scenario and strategizing for enhanced law enforcement measures.

SSP Samba Vinay Kumar extended a warm welcome to ADGP Jammu on behalf of the District Police Samba and initiated the proceedings by presenting a detailed analysis of crime data through a presentation.

The review session commenced with a meticulous examination of crime statistics on a police station level, focusing primarily on the expeditious disposal of pending cases. ADGP Jammu emphasized the need for prompt resolution of cases registered in the current year as well as those pending from previous years. Supervisory Officers and Investigating Officers received comprehensive directives aimed at enhancing the quality of investigations and expediting the closure of pending cases.

Special attention was given to serious criminal offenses, thefts, burglaries, and narcotic-related cases, with directives issued to intensify efforts in their investigation and resolution. Detailed discussions were held regarding cases falling under the Narcotic Drugs and Psychotropic Substances (NDPS) Act, with a specific focus on unraveling the intricate networks involved and bolstering conviction rates.

Furthermore, deliberations were conducted on curbing bovine smuggling activities, alongside emphasizing proactive measures to apprehend absconders and trace missing individuals. ADGP Jammu stressed the importance of conducting regular crime meetings between supervisory officers and investigating personnel to ensure seamless investigations leading to conclusive outcomes. Additionally, instructions were provided to enhance the efficiency of the Police Beat System for improved policing.

Post the meeting, ADGP Jammu conducted an inspection of the recently established Cyber Cell and NAFIS lab at the DPO Samba, assessing their operational efficacy. He also visited the CCTNS labs at various levels of command within the district, including those at SSP Samba, Additional SP Samba, and DySP Headquarters Samba, to gain insights into their functioning. Additionally, a visit to Police Station Samba facilitated a review of operational aspects such as Roznamcha maintenance, CCTNS lab operations, Malkhana management, and the functioning of the Women Cell. The visit and subsequent review underscored the commitment of law enforcement authorities toward ensuring a robust crime control mechanism and enhancing public safety within the Samba district.
